Salalah in the Al-Sarb Season, which refers to the period immediately following the monsoon (Khareef), offers a quieter, greener, and more temperate version of Oman\u2019s Dhofar region. Here\u2019s why this magical window from mid-September to early December should be on your 2025 travel bucket list.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<hr class=\"w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ity\"\/>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">What is Al-Sarb Season?<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Al-Sarb season comes right after the monsoon winds have transformed the Dhofar mountains and valleys into a green paradise. From <strong>mid-September through November<\/strong>, the rains subside, but the greenery remains. This transitional period brings clear skies, gentle winds, and perfect temperatures\u2014ideal for outdoor adventures. Unlike the peak Khareef season, Al-Sarb offers a <strong>more relaxed and authentic experience<\/strong>, with fewer crowds and better access to local nature spots.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<hr class=\"w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ity\"\/>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">The Weather: A Dream Come True for Europeans<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Europeans escaping grey autumn skies will find Salalah\u2019s weather refreshingly different. Expect daytime temperatures ranging between <strong>22\u00b0C and 28\u00b0C<\/strong>, with cool evenings perfect for stargazing. Humidity drops significantly compared to the monsoon months, making hiking and exploring far more enjoyable.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>This climate is especially attractive to travelers from <strong>Germany, Poland, Czech Republic, and Italy<\/strong>, where October and November can be quite cold and dark.
